Comprehensive Guide to Water Depth Samplers and Their Applications

Accurate water quality monitoring is crucial in various fields, from environmental science and aquaculture to industrial wastewater management. A key tool for this is the water depth sampler. This article provides an in-depth look at water depth samplers, their applications, types, and essential considerations for choosing the right one for your needs. We'll explore the benefits of utilizing this equipment to collect reliable data for analysis and informed decision-making. Selecting the right sampler can significantly improve the precision and efficiency of your water monitoring program. A water depth sampler, also known as a depth-integrated sampler, is a device designed to collect water samples from specific depths within a body of water. Unlike simply dipping a container into the water, a depth sampler allows for collection of a representative sample across a defined depth range. This is critical because water properties (temperature, salinity, pollutants) often vary significantly with depth. The data gathered with a water depth sampler provides a more accurate assessment of water quality than surface samples alone.

Comprehensive Guide to Selecting the Right Surface Water Sampler for Your Needs

Monitoring the quality of surface water is critical for environmental protection, public health, and various industrial applications. A surface water sampler is an essential tool for collecting representative samples from rivers, lakes, ponds, and other surface water sources. This article provides a detailed overview of surface water samplers, their types, applications, and key considerations for selecting the right equipment. Accurate water quality data relies on proper sample collection, and choosing the correct sampler is the first step toward achieving reliable results. Surface water samplers come in various designs, each suited to specific sampling needs. Common types include grab samplers, depth-integrating samplers, peristaltic pumps, and automatic samplers. Surface water samplers are used across a broad spectrum of applications, including environmental monitoring, wastewater discharge monitoring, drinking water source monitoring, agricultural runoff analysis, and research studies.
